(DALIANNEWS)- A delegation leading by Klaus Schwab, executive chairman and founder of the World Economic Forum visited Dalian, a coastal city of northeastern China's Liaoning Province, March 17, 2007, showing their great confidence in the city's holding the event of the "Summer Davos" in September this year.
Dalian has been mainly in heavy industry, but now is very fast moving into hi-tech industry, thus Dalian is an ideal location for holding the annual meeting of Global Growth Companies (GGC), said Klaus Schwab, executive chairman and founder of the World Economic Forum.
Klaus Schwab also say Chinese companies will gain great benefits from this "Summer Davos", for they will have the chance to communicate with the international large-scale companies and learn the environment and trend of the present world's economic development.
The "Summer Davos" will serve as a platform to link growth companies from across the world, seeking cooperation and development,Klaus Schwab added.
